Простые числа важны в области информационной безопасности, потому что они используются в криптографии для создания безопасных паролей, шифров и защиты данных. xn--80aakcbevmvw9p.xn--p1ai
Несколько причин важности простых чисел в этой сфере:
- Сложность факторизации целых чисел. www.geeksforgeeks.org Разложение на простые множители — сложная вычислительная задача, особенно для больших чисел с двумя большими простыми множителями. www.geeksforgeeks.org
- Криптография с открытым ключом. www.geeksforgeeks.org Например, в алгоритме RSA открытый ключ генерируется из произведения двух больших простых чисел. www.geeksforgeeks.org Безопасность системы зависит от вычислительной задачи факторизации результирующего составного числа. www.geeksforgeeks.org
- Генерация случайных чисел. www.geeksforgeeks.org Большие простые числа могут служить основой для генерации псевдослучайных чисел, что повышает безопасность криптографических систем. www.geeksforgeeks.org
- Безопасность за счёт сложности. www.geeksforgeeks.org Сложность операций с простыми числами обеспечивает высокий уровень безопасности, затрудняя злоумышленникам возможность скомпрометировать криптографические алгоритмы. www.geeksforgeeks.org
Таким образом, простые числа обеспечивают конфиденциальность и целостность информации в современных протоколах связи и информационной безопасности. www.geeksforgeeks.org